For a while, my wife was writing a work on heavy metals (lead, cadmium, arsen, mercury) in food. By the time she was halfway through it, we got connected to the Web, and I was in charge of surfing and finding any relevant material. To our utter amazement, there was a gaping absence of any work on the matter coming from USA. We found articles from all parts of the world, and the freshest ones from the States were years old and were about lead mines or a couple of industrial plants affecting their vicinity. There was no trace of any serious investigation of the content of heavy metals in food items. I didn't do any serious search on that for at least five years, but I'd figure the results may well be the same.

In that work she had thousands of numbers (that I crunched and munched in various spreadsheets on Atari and PCs, plus mFoxPlus etc) with years of laboratory findings on these four metals in wheat, flour, bread, cakes, additives and dough in general. They were done by a local laboratory for the city bakery, at least once a month.

So if a local city bakery had paid for those analysi for years, in a semi-developed Balkan country, something seems to be very fishy if nothing of a kind can be found here.
